The term for the tube with a closed end is call a "thermowell". Normally they are stainless. The ones for brewing can be very long, 30cm. You can pick up all sorts of them from aliexpress.
Then, as BennoG says, I'd stuff a bunch of probes down them. Personally I'd much prefer proper 3 wire pt100 probes, you can also get them from "funny bunny"'s store.
He has the ones without covers, they are pretty easy to work with mechanically as the junction is only a mm or so. That would be very easy to wire and stuff.

This said, the normal MAX31865 is an spi device and you only get one probe per chip.  (I have good multiple board esp-idf drivers if you go this way and want them).

Your other option, DS18B20 would be much easier, they can all be run straight to your MCU with no driver board, they are quite precise. With .5 degrees of a PT100 based on my experience using them quite a bit. (They need pullups btw). The biggest down side would be getting a lot of them in a thermo well. 

ps, 0.1 is quite easy for the pt100. That's why I aim for.

I also have a pt100 on a bonded teflon tube. You could just fix these together and pull them apart for cleaning. Food safe, acid safe to the max. Not safe amongst forever chemical fear-mongers, unless you want top go past 550.

Pogo pins are not normally used with that style of test point.  You are generally better off probing without a through hole test point, onto a bare SMT pad or maybe an open through hole pad.
There are various head designs like the crown point that can help probe a non-flat surface.

That style of test point are not so commonly used these days, except in R&D.  You would normally use a hook type test clip with them, like seen in the photo at top right.

Are you planning to use pogo pins from above or below the PCB?
If you were probing from above, you might be able to use a large concave (inverted cone) head pogo, like a P25-A2 or P100-A2.
If probing from below, it would depend on how much the particular style of test points used protrude from the PCB surface.
